What I find particularly interesting is that verbosity in and of itself doesn't bother me. I work primarily with Objective C and Cocoa these days, where the convention is to use long names like "componentsSeparatedByString:" instead of "split()", but I'm OK with it since it basically cuts down on the number of comments I have to write and maintain. What bugs me about Java's verbosity is that it doesn't add much in terms of readability, and in some cases detracts from it.
